The Environmental, Health, and Safety (EHS) Specialist will be responsible for ensuring the safety and well-being of employees, compliance with environmental regulations, and promoting a culture of safety throughout the organization. This role involves managing EHS programs, conducting risk assessments, training employees, and driving continuous improvements in environmental and safety practices. This role requires a strong understanding of safety regulations, industry standards, and the ability to communicate complex information effectively. The ideal candidate will have a strong knowledge of electrical safety and a proactive approach to risk management and incident prevention. This position reports to the Director of EHS and will work onsite at ZincFive headquarters in Tualatin, Oregon.
EHS Specialist Job Duties :
- Help develop, implement, and manage EHS programs, policies, and procedures to 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ations
- Drive the adoption of safety best practices and promote a Zero Harm safety culture across the organization
- Maintain safety awareness training programs, ensuring that all employees understand EHS protocols and compliance requirements
- Stay current on regulatory changes, ensuring the company remains compliant with OSHA, EPA, and other relevant health, safety, and environmental regulations
- Advise management on regulatory requirements, ensure the timely submission of EHS-related permits, reports, documentation, and track findings
- Perform risk assessments and hazard evaluations to identify potential workplace hazards and recommend mitigation strategies
- Responsible for creating, updating, and maintaining various safety manuals, procedures, training materials, reports, and other technical documents related to workplace health and safety
- Lead investigations of workplace accidents, injuries, near misses, and environmental incidents using root cause analysis techniques
- Develop and implement corrective actions to prevent recurrence and ensure continuous improvement of safety programs
- Report findings appropriately post investigation
- Conduct safety training programs for new hires and ongoing employee education to enhance safety awareness and regulatory compliance
- Promote safety communication through regular meetings, training sessions, and safety campaigns to engage all employees in EHS initiatives
- Participate in Safety Committee Meetings
- Conduct regular EHS audits, inspections, and assessments to ensure compliance with established safety standards and regulatory requirements
- Provide management with regular reports, performance metrics, and recommendations based on safety audits and incident trends.
- Assist in the development and implementation of emergency response plans, including fire, spill, and evacuation procedures
- Lead emergency drills to ensure all employees are prepared and know how to respond in the event of an emergency
- Collaborate on environmental sustainability initiatives, focusing on waste reduction, energy conservation, and meeting key performance indicators
- Support the company’s efforts to achieve and maintain ISO 14001 (Environmental Management) and ISO 45001 (Occupational Health and Safety) certifications
